The Big Jobs: Commercial and Industrial Expertise

For large-scale projects, the stakes are high. Commercial electrical work requires meticulous planning, adherence to strict safety regulations, and the ability to manage timelines effectively. In Perth’s competitive construction landscape, large jobs typically involve:

  • New Builds and Construction: Full-scale wiring for residential developments or commercial towers.

  • Data and Communications: Structured cabling for offices to ensure high-speed internet and network reliability.

  • Switchboard Upgrades: Modernizing old systems to handle increased electrical loads, which is crucial for safety.

  • LED Lighting Conversions: Retrofitting large warehouses or retail spaces to reduce energy overheads.

The Small Jobs: Detail and Efficiency

While big jobs get the headlines, the “small jobs” are often the ones that build a reputation. These tasks require agility. A homeowner doesn’t want to wait two weeks for a simple repair, nor do they want to pay a premium that covers overheads for massive construction sites. Small jobs are the bread and butter of a reliable electrical service and include:

  • Emergency Repairs: Smoke alarm replacements, tripping circuits, or sparking outlets.

  • Fixture Installations: Ceiling fans, pendant lights, and security sensor lights.

  • Renovation Support: Moving power points or adding data ports during kitchen or bathroom remodels.

  • Safety Inspections: Pre-purchase safety checks or switchboard assessments.

A Focus on Preventative Safety

Electrical issues rarely fix themselves. Leading contractors focus on identifying potential hazards before they become emergencies. During any service call—big or small—a top-tier electrician will often perform a cursory safety check of the switchboard and visible wiring. This preventative approach not only saves money in the long run but also ensures the safety of the occupants.

For those seeking Electrical Contractors Perth, it is advisable to look for a team that emphasizes compliance with Australian Standards (AS/NZS 3000). Safety compliance is not a “bonus”; it is the bare minimum, and the best in the business go above and beyond to ensure every connection is secure.

How to Choose the Right Electrician for Your Needs

To ensure you are hiring a partner capable of handling both the big picture and the fine details, consider the following checklist:

  • Licensing and Insurance: Always verify that the contractor holds a current electrical license and public liability insurance. This protects you in the event of accidental damage.

  • Range of Services: Look for a team that lists both residential and commercial capabilities. A contractor who does both often has a wider range of problem-solving skills.

  • Communication: Pay attention to how they handle your initial inquiry. Are they responsive? Do they answer your questions clearly?

  • Local Reputation: In Perth, word of mouth and online reviews carry significant weight. Look for consistent feedback regarding punctuality and workmanship.
